EAS Build -p Android -Профиль Производство не удалось, но NPX Expo Run: Android успехAndroid

Форум для тех, кто программирует под Android
Ответить
Anonymous
 EAS Build -p Android -Профиль Производство не удалось, но NPX Expo Run: Android успех

Сообщение Anonymous »

Мой проект использует React Native Expo Bare Workflow.
Я пытаюсь обновить свое приложение для исправления новейшего требования от Google Console:
Приложение должно поддерживать 16 кб -страниц < /press> < /p>
При выполнении команды: < /p>
npx expo expo expo expo> androd expo expo> androd expo> androd expo expo> androd. Успех, и я могу проверить его с эмулятором Android с размерами страниц памяти 16 КБ. Все показывают 16 КБ, и это соответствует требованиям.
Но после попытки загрузить на Dashboard Expo, используя эту команду:
eas Build -p Android -Profile Production

Я продолжаю получать ошибку от некоторых модулей. Модули: < /p>

[*] React-cnync-storage_async-storage < /li>
react-community_datetimepicker < /li>
react-native-community_netinfo < /li>
/> lottie-react-cnative < /li>
react-cnive-device-info < /li>
react-native-fs < /li>
react-cand-gesture-handler < /li>
Реактивно-символ-кольцевой кольцевой кольцо < /li> < /li>
Реактивно-символьный кольцевой кольцевой кольцо < /li> < /li>
-react-inative-inative-inative-crop-picker < /li> < /li>
/> React-cnative-mmkv < /li>
react-can-pager-view < /li>
React-native-photo-manipulator < /li>
React-Cniate-reanimated < /li>
React-native-safe-are-context < /li>
react-native-safe-are-context < /li>
/>react-native-screens
[*]react-native-snackbar
[*]react-native-vector-icons
[*]react-native-video
[*]react-native-vision-camera
[*]react-native-webview
React-Kind-worklets < /li>
< /ol>
Ошибка: < /strong> < /p>

Код: Выделить всё

FAILURE: Build failed with an exception.
* What went wrong: Could not determine the dependencies of task ':app:buildReleasePreBundle'.
> Could not resolve all dependencies for configuration ':app:releaseRuntimeClasspath'.
> Could not resolve project :react-native-async-storage_async-storage.
Required by:
project :app
> No matching variant of project :react-native-async-storage_async-storage was found. The consumer was configured to find a library for use during runtime, preferably optimized for Android, as well as attribute 'com.android.build.api.attributes.AgpVersionAttr' with value '8.11.0', attribute 'com.android.build.api.attributes.BuildTypeAttr' with value 'release', attribute 'org.jetbrains.kotlin.platform.type' with value 'androidJvm' but:
- No variants exist.
для получения дополнительной информации. Проверьте скриншот. src = "https://i.sstatic.net/2fwtvorm.jpg"/>

это : [/b]

Код: Выделить всё

{
"name": "app_name",
"version": "1.0.0",
"main": "node_modules/expo/AppEntry.js",
"scripts": {
"start": "expo start",
"android": "expo run:android",
"ios": "expo run:ios",
"web": "expo start --web"
},
"dependencies": {
"@react-native-async-storage/async-storage": "2.2.0",
"@react-native-community/datetimepicker": "8.4.4",
"@react-native-community/netinfo": "11.4.1",
"@react-navigation/bottom-tabs": "^7.4.7",
"@react-navigation/drawer": "^7.5.8",
"@react-navigation/material-top-tabs": "^7.3.7",
"@react-navigation/native": "^7.1.17",
"@react-navigation/native-stack": "^7.3.26",
"@reduxjs/toolkit": "^2.9.0",
"@rneui/base": "^4.0.0-rc.8",
"@rneui/themed": "^4.0.0-rc.8",
"@shopify/react-native-skia": "2.2.12",
"axios": "^1.12.2",
"expo": "~54.0.10",
"expo-clipboard": "~8.0.7",
"expo-device": "~8.0.8",
"expo-font": "~14.0.8",
"expo-image": "~3.0.8",
"expo-image-picker": "~17.0.8",
"expo-linear-gradient": "~15.0.7",
"expo-screen-orientation": "~9.0.7",
"expo-secure-store": "~15.0.7",
"expo-sharing": "~14.0.7",
"expo-splash-screen": "~31.0.10",
"expo-status-bar": "~3.0.8",
"expo-system-ui": "~6.0.7",
"expo-updates": "~29.0.11",
"expo-video": "~3.0.11",
"expo-web-browser": "~15.0.7",
"formik": "^2.4.6",
"lottie-react-native": "~7.3.1",
"react": "19.1.0",
"react-intl": "^7.1.11",
"react-native": "0.81.4",
"react-native-device-info": "^14.1.1",
"react-native-dropdown-picker": "^5.4.6",
"react-native-fs": "^2.20.0",
"react-native-gesture-handler": "~2.28.0",
"react-native-image-crop-picker": "^0.51.0",
"react-native-international-phone-number": "^0.10.8",
"react-native-mmkv": "^3.3.3",
"react-native-otp-entry": "^1.8.5",
"react-native-pager-view": "6.9.1",
"react-native-photo-manipulator": "^1.9.2",
"react-native-reanimated": "~4.1.1",
"react-native-reanimated-carousel": "^4.0.3",
"react-native-recaptcha-that-works": "^2.0.0",
"react-native-render-html": "^6.3.4",
"react-native-safe-area-context": "~5.6.0",
"react-native-screens": "~4.16.0",
"react-native-snackbar": "^2.9.0",
"react-native-switch": "^1.5.1",
"react-native-tab-view": "^4.1.3",
"react-native-timeline-flatlist": "^0.8.0",
"react-native-vector-icons": "^10.3.0",
"react-native-video": "^6.16.1",
"react-native-vision-camera": "^4.7.2",
"react-native-webview": "13.15.0",
"react-native-worklets": "0.5.1",
"react-redux": "^9.2.0",
"redux-persist": "^6.0.0",
"swr": "^2.3.6",
"yup": "^1.7.1"
},
"devDependencies": {
"@babel/core": "^7.28.4"
},
"private": true
}
Это мой gradle-wrapper.properties:

Код: Выделить всё

dist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-8.14.3-bin.zip
networkTimeout=10000
validateDistributionUrl=true
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
Это моя build.gradle:
// Top-level build file where you can add configuration options common to all sub-projects/modules.

buildscript {
ext {
targetSdkVersion = '35'
}

repositories {
google()
mavenCentral()
}
dependencies {
classpath('com.android.tools.build:gradle')
classpath('com.facebook.react:react-native-gradle-plugin')
classpath('org.jetbrains.kotlin:kotlin-gradle-plugin')
}
}

allprojects {
repositories {
google()
mavenCentral()
maven { url 'https://www.jitpack.io' }
}
}

apply plugin: "expo-root-project"
apply plugin: "com.facebook.react.rootproject"
< /code>
Поиск повсюду, спросите Chatgpt, спросите DeepSeek. Не могу найти проблему.
Так как ее исправить?

Подробнее здесь: https://stackoverflow.com/questions/797 ... roid-succe
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Android»